Grilled Chicken Wings Recipe with Spicy Comeback Sauce
Chicken wings get a facelift! This Grilled chicken wings recipe has serious smokey bbq flavor!
Ingredients
- 4 lbs chicken wing pieces
- 1 teaspoon salt
- 1 teaspoon black pepper
- 1 teaspoon paprika
- 1 teaspoon olive oil
Spicy Comeback Sauce
- 1 cup mayonnaise
- 1/4 Sambal Oelek red chili paste (found in the Thai Section)
- 1 tablespoon lemon juice
- 2 tablespoons ketchup
- 2 teaspoons Worcestershire sauce
- 1 teaspoon ground mustard
- 1/2 teaspoon onion powder
- 1 clove garlic, crushed
- 1/2 teaspoon salt
- 1/2 teaspoon pepper
Instructions
- In a large bowl, drizzle chicken with olive oil. Sprinkle with salt, pepper, and paprika. Spray grill grate with non stick spray. Heat your grill over medium heat. Grill wrings for 20-25 minutes or until crispy. Be sure to turn chicken halfway through cook time.
- While chicken cooks, prepare sauce. In a bowl, combine all sauce ingredients. Stir until completely mixed. Refrigerate until ready to serve.
